中国电信网站备案 密码重置怎么在网站上建设投票统计

张小明 2026/1/13 7:11:31
中国电信网站备案 密码重置,怎么在网站上建设投票统计,一家只做性价比的网站,有哪些做留学资讯的网站13.1 联结联结是利用SQL的SELECT能执行的最重要的操作#xff0c;很好地理解联结及其语法是学习SQL的一个极为重要的组成部分。13.1.1 关系表外键为某个表中的一列#xff0c;它包含另一个表的主键值#xff0c;定义了两个表之间的关系。这样做的好处如下#xff1a;信息不…13.1 联结联结是利用SQL的SELECT能执行的最重要的操作很好地理解联结及其语法是学习SQL的一个极为重要的组成部分。13.1.1 关系表外键为某个表中的一列它包含另一个表的主键值定义了两个表之间的关系。这样做的好处如下信息不重复从而不浪费时间和空间如果信息变动可以只更新一个表中的单个记录相关表中的数据不用改动由于数据无重复显然数据是一致的这使得处理数据更简单关系数据可以有效地存储和方便地处理。因此关系数据库的可伸缩性远比非关系数据库要好。能够适应不断增加的工作量而不失败。设计良好的数据库或应用程序称之为可伸缩性好scale well。13.1.2 为什么要使用联结联结是一种机制用来在一条SELECT语句中关联表因此称之为联结。使用特殊的语法可以联结多个表返回一组输出联结在运行时关联表中正确的行。要维护引用完整性要理解联结不是物理实体。换句话说它在实际的数据库表中不存在。联结由MySQL根据需要建立它存在于查询的执行当中。在使用关系表时仅在关系列中插入合法的数据非常重要。为防止这种情况发生可指示MySQL只允许在表的主键列中出现合法值。这就是维护引用完整性它是通过在表的定义中指定主键和外键来实现的。13.2 创建联结联结的创建非常简单规定要联结的所有表以及它们如何关联即可。SELECT vend_name,prod_name,prod_price FROM vendors,products WHERE vendors.vend_id products.vend_id ORDER BY vend_name,prod_name;分析SELECT语句与前面所有语句一样指定要检索的列。这里最大的差别是所指定的两个列prod_name和prod_price在一个表中而另一个列vend_name在另一个表中。与以前的SELECT语句不一样这条语句的FROM子句列出了两个表分别是vendors和products。它们就是这条SELECT语句联结的两个表的名字。这两个表用WHERE子句正确联结WHERE子句指示MySQL匹配vendors表中的vend_id和products表中的vend_id。要匹配的两个列以vendors.vend_id和products.vend_id指定。这里需要这种完全限定列名因为如果只给出vend_id则MySQL不知道指的是哪一个它们有两个每个表中一个。在引用的列可能出现二义性时必须使用完全限定列名用一个点分隔的表名和列名。如果引用一个没有用表名限制的具有二义性的列名MySQL将返回错误。13.2.1 WHERE子句的重要性在一条SELECT语句中联结几个表时相应的关系是在运行中构造的。在数据库表的定义中不存在能指示MySQL如何对表进行联结的东西。你必须自己做这件事情。在联结两个表时你实际上做的是将第一个表中的每一行与第二个表中的每一行配对。WHERE子句作为过滤条件它只包含那些匹配给定条件这里是联结条件的行。没有WHERE子句第一个表中的每个行将与第二个表中的每个行配对而不管它们逻辑上是否可以配在一起。笛卡尔积由没有联结条件的表关系返回的结果为笛卡儿积。检索出的行的数目将是第一个表中的行数乘以第二个表中的行数。应该保证所有联结都有WHERE子句否则MySQL将返回比想要的数据多得多的数据。同理应该保证WHERE子句的正确性。不正确的过滤条件将导致MySQL返回不正确的数据。有时我们会听到返回称为叉联结cross join的笛卡儿积的联结类型。13.2.2 内部联结目前为止所用的联结称为等值联结equijoin它基于两个表之间的相等测试。这种联结也称为内部联结。SELECT vend_name,prod_name,prod_price FROM vendors INNER JOIN products ON vendors.vend_id products.vend_id;分析此语句中的SELECT与前面的SELECT语句相同但FROM子句不同。这里两个表之间的关系是FROM子句的组成部分以INNER JOIN指定。在使用这种语法时联结条件用特定的ON子句而不是WHERE子句给出。传递给ON的实际条件与传递给WHERE的相同。ANSI SQL规范首选INNER JOIN语法。此外尽管使用WHERE子句定义联结的确比较简单但是使用明确的联结语法能够确保不会忘记联结条件有时候这样做也能影响性能。13.2.3 联结多个表SQL对一条SELECT语句中可以联结的表的数目没有限制。创建联结的基本规则也相同。SELECT prod_name,vend_name,prod_price,quantity FROM orderitems,products,vendors WHERE products.vend_id vendors.vend_id AND orderitems.prod_id products.prod_id AND order_num 20005;分析此例子显示编号为20005的订单中的物品。订单物品存储在orderitems表中。每个产品按其产品ID存储它引用products表中的产品。这些产品通过供应商ID联结到vendors表中相应的供应商供应商ID存储在每个产品的记录中。这里的FROM子句列出了3个表而WHERE子句定义了这两个联结条件而第三个联结条件用来过滤出订单20005中的物品。MySQL在运行时关联指定的每个表以处理联结。这种处理可能是非常耗费资源的因此应该仔细不要联结不必要的表。联结的表越多性能下降越厉害。为执行任一给定的SQL操作一般存在不止一种方法。很少有绝对正确或绝对错误的方法。性能可能会受操作类型、表中数据量、是否存在索引或键以及其他一些条件的影响。因此有必要对不同的选择机制进行实验以找出最适合具体情况的方法。
版权声明:本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!

厦门网站建设代理企业网上登记注册

第一个驱动程序 创建空项目删除.inf文件关闭将警告视为错误设置驱动在什么操作系统运行 代码&#xff1a; #include<ntifs.h> //卸载函数 VOID DriverUnload(PDRIVER_OBJECT pDriver) {DbgPrint("(mydriver)驱动程序停止运行了。\n"); }NTSTATUS DriverEntry(P…

张小明 2026/1/3 2:35:20 网站建设

一台电脑如何做网站家庭农场网站建设

FaceFusion镜像支持按Token用量阶梯计价 在短视频内容爆炸式增长的今天&#xff0c;AI驱动的人脸替换技术早已不再是影视特效工作室的专属工具。从虚拟主播换脸直播&#xff0c;到广告创意快速生成&#xff0c;再到社交平台的趣味滤镜&#xff0c;高质量、低门槛的人脸编辑能力…

张小明 2026/1/2 11:54:59 网站建设

最新企业网站软件开发平台 devcloud

橙单低代码平台实战指南&#xff1a;3天搭建企业级多租户应用 【免费下载链接】orange-form 橙单中台化低代码生成器。可完整支持多应用、多租户、多渠道、工作流 (Flowable & Activiti)、在线表单、自定义数据同步、自定义Job、多表关联、跨服务多表关联、框架技术栈自由组…

张小明 2026/1/10 18:32:13 网站建设

建站公司用的开源系统优化推荐

在基础电子元器件中&#xff0c;电阻是最常见也最“多变”的一类。除了固定阻值的标准电阻&#xff0c;还有一类被称为“敏感电阻”的特殊元件——它们的阻值会随着外界物理量&#xff08;如温度、光照、电压等&#xff09;的变化而动态调整。其中&#xff0c;热敏电阻、光敏电…

张小明 2026/1/10 4:19:21 网站建设

淘宝客返利网站建设wordpress文件插件

一&#xff0c;什么是父子进程子进程是父进程的一个复制品(副本)。从linux 2.6 之后 &#xff08;ubuntu 18 linux 5.4&#xff09;子进程在复制父进程内存空间的时候,执行写时复制。刚fork完毕&#xff0c;子进程使用的内存空间全部都是父进程的(子进程共享父进程所以的空间)。…

张小明 2025/12/30 12:19:27 网站建设

深圳最简单的网站建设wordpress手机端和pc端兼容

【摘要】AI正加速融入心理咨询&#xff0c;显著提升服务效率。但其应用必须审慎处理数据隐私、算法偏见及输出不可靠性等核心风险&#xff0c;通过建立严谨的治理框架与分级应用策略&#xff0c;确保技术在人类专家监督下&#xff0c;安全、负责任地发挥辅助作用。引言人工智能…

张小明 2026/1/5 19:13:15 网站建设